The Flea

A new member of Jim Merricks White's 30% bugs family: the Flea.

Inspired by David Barr's Hypergolic, Jim published the latest design in his series of 30% split keyboards with various levels of splay.

The splay is a little different from the Midge and the Mosquito, with none between the index and middle finger and an extra 5 degrees between the ring and pinkie. This pushes the pinkie out a little bit while also pulling the thumb in. The thumb cluster has a slightly inverted splay to match – jamesmnw.

Source files for the Flea are available on GitHub: https://github.com/jimmerricks/bugs/tree/master/pcbs/flea.
